The Bright Side of Lighting House Design

Designing a lighting house means thinking about how light affects the mood of a room. The right indoor lighting can change everything. It’s all about finding the right balance between light and dark.

Light temperature is key in lighting house design. It can be warm white or cool white, changing the feel of a room. Warm white lights make spaces cozy, while cool white lights energize them. Mixing these can create a unique atmosphere.

Understanding Light Temperature

Light temperature is measured in Kelvin (K). Warm white lights are between 2700K and 3000K. Cool white lights are between 3500K and 5000K. Choose your light fixtures based on the mood you want to create.

The Psychology of Light

The way light affects us is important in lighting house design. Bright, cool white lights can make us more alert. Warm, soft lights help us relax. Knowing this can help you design a space that supports your well-being.

Light TemperatureColor ToneAmbiance
Warm White (2700K-3000K)Cozy and IntimateRelaxing and Calming
Cool White (3500K-5000K)Energized and RefreshingInvigorating and Focused

By using indoor lighting ideas and understanding light psychology, you can make a lighting house that looks good and works well. Balance light and dark to create a space that feels right for you.

Illuminating the Basics: Your Home Lighting Guide

home lighting solutions

Choosing the right home lighting solutions can be overwhelming. It’s key to grasp the basics of lighting design. A well-lit home boosts ambiance and function. To get there, pick indoor lighting ideas that fit your needs.

Start by knowing the different lighting types. Ambient lighting lights up the whole room. Task lighting is for specific activities, like reading. Accent lighting highlights certain areas or features.

Popular home lighting solutions include table lamps, floor lamps, and ceiling fixtures. When picking lighting, think about:

  • Room size and layout
  • Natural light availability
  • Task requirements
  • Personal style and preferences

Understanding these points and exploring indoor lighting ideas helps create a lighting plan. It should meet your needs and improve your home’s feel. Aim for a balance between function and beauty for a welcoming space.

Lighting TypeDescriptionExample
Ambient LightingOverall illuminationCeiling fixtures
Task LightingSpecific task illuminationTable lamps
Accent LightingHighlighting features or areasWall sconces

Room-by-Room Lighting House Solutions

home lighting solutions

Every room in your home has its own lighting needs. A well-thought-out lighting plan can greatly improve each space. It’s key to think about what each room needs for the best lighting.

In the kitchen, you need good task lighting for cooking and food prep. Under-cabinet lights help, and pendant lights add style. The living room benefits from ambient lighting for a cozy feel. Accent lights can highlight special spots, like a fireplace or art.

Kitchen Lighting Strategies

  • Use under-cabinet lighting to illuminate countertops
  • Install pendant lights above the island or sink
  • Consider recessed lighting for overall illumination

Living Room Illumination

  • Use table lamps or floor lamps for ambient lighting
  • Install accent lighting to highlight specific areas
  • Consider using dimmers to adjust the lighting levels

Knowing what each room needs for lighting helps create a home that’s both beautiful and functional. The right lighting can make your home more welcoming and comfortable.

RoomLighting NeedsRecommended Lighting
KitchenTask lightingUnder-cabinet lighting, pendant lights
Living RoomAmbient lighting, accent lightingTable lamps, floor lamps, dimmers
BedroomSoft, warm lightingTable lamps, string lights
BathroomBright, energizing lightingRecessed lighting, LED lights

Seasonal Lighting Adjustments and Tips

As the seasons change, it’s key to adjust your lighting system. This makes your outdoor lighting design and lighting house better. It also saves energy and keeps your home safe.

Seasonal lighting changes are important. In summer, we need to use light wisely to save energy and avoid heat. Winter lighting makes your home cozy and inviting.

Summer Light Management

In summer, using energy-saving light bulbs is crucial. Also, install motion sensors and adjust your lights’ timing. These steps help cut down energy use.

Winter Lighting Strategies

In winter, we aim for a warm and welcoming feel. Use warm light bulbs, add string lights, and put in pathway lights. These help light up walkways and driveways.

Holiday Lighting Special Considerations

Holidays bring special lighting needs. Use energy-efficient lights, avoid too many lights on one circuit, and set timers. These steps keep your lights working well and festive.

By following these tips, you can enhance your outdoor lighting design and lighting house. You’ll also save energy and keep your home safe.

SeasonLighting Tips
SummerUse energy-efficient light bulbs, install motion sensors, and adjust timing
WinterUse warm-toned light bulbs, add string lights, and install pathway lights
HolidaysUse energy-efficient holiday lights, avoid overloading circuits, and install a timer
